标题:学习Java软件的必备基础知识及最佳学习路径和方法
在当今信息技术高速发展的时代,Java作为一种广泛应用的编程语言,对于想要从事软件开发或者提升职业竞争力的人来说,学习Java软件是一个明智的选择。然而,学习任何一门新技术都需要一定的基础知识和正确的学习方法。本文将为您介绍学习Java软件所需的基础知识,并探讨选择合适教材和资源、最佳学习路径和方法以及如何应用于实际项目中。
一、学习Java软件的必备基础知识
1. 编程基础:了解计算机科学基本概念、数据结构与算法、面向对象编程等内容,这些是理解和掌握Java语言的基础。
2. 基本语法:掌握Java语言的关键字、数据类型、运算符、控制流程等基本语法知识。
3. 面向对象思想:理解类与对象、封装、继承和多态等面向对象编程概念,并能够运用到实际问题中。
4. 数据库基础:熟悉SQL语言以及关系数据库的基本操作,如表的创建、查询、更新和删除等。
二、选择合适的学习Java软件的教材和资源
1. 书籍:选择经典的Java编程教材,如《Java核心技术》、《Thinking in Java》等,这些教材通常包含了全面而深入的Java知识。
2. 在线资源:利用网络资源进行学习,例如Oracle官方文档、Java官方网站、各类编程论坛和博客等,这些资源提供了丰富的学习资料和实例代码。
3. 视频教程:通过观看优质的Java软件教学视频,可以更直观地理解和掌握相关知识。
三、学习Java软件的最佳学习路径和方法
1. 系统性学习:按照从基础到高级逐步深入的顺序进行学习,建议先掌握语法基础,然后再深入了解面向对象编程思想以及常用类库等。
2. 实践项目:通过参与实际项目或者完成小型练习项目来巩固所学知识,并将理论应用到实际中去。
3. 参与社区:加入各类技术社区或者开发者论坛,与其他开发者交流经验和问题,不断学习和提升。
四、掌握Java软件开发的关键技能和技巧
1. 深入理解Java虚拟机:了解Java虚拟机的工作原理和内存管理机制,可以帮助优化程序性能。
2. 掌握常用的开发工具:熟练使用Eclipse、IntelliJ IDEA等集成开发环境,以及各种调试和性能分析工具。
3. 学习框架和库:掌握Spring、Hibernate等流行的Java开发框架,提高开发效率。
4. 注重代码质量:编写规范、可读性强且易于维护的代码,并养成良好的编码习惯。
五、学习Java软件后如何应用于实际项目中
1. 实践项目经验:通过参与实际项目,将所学知识运用到实际中去,并积累项目经验。
2. 开源项目参与:加入开源社区,参与开源项目的贡献和改进,提升自己在Java软件开发领域的影响力。
3. 自主项目实施:尝试独立完成一些小型个人项目或者应用程序,锻炼自己在实际应用中解决问题的能力。
六、学习Java软件后如何提升自己的职业竞争力
1. 持续学习:Java技术在不断更新和演进,保持学习的热情,关注最新的技术发展趋势,不断提升自己的技能水平。
2. 认证考试:参加相关的Java认证考试,如Oracle Certified Java Programmer(OCPJP),获得官方认可的资质证书。
3. 参与开发社区:积极参与技术社区或者开源项目,与其他开发者交流和分享经验,扩展人脉圈。
总结起来,学习Java软件需要具备一定的基础知识,并选择合适的教材和资源进行学习。在学习过程中,要坚持系统性学习、实践项目、参与社区等方法,并掌握关键技能和技巧。将所学知识应用于实际项目中,并通过持续学习和提升自己的职业竞争力。相信通过努力和实践,您一定能够成为一名优秀的Java软件开发者。


还没有评论,来说两句吧...